本书是一本系统介绍一个地理信息系统底层开发的完整教程,讲授如何通过程序语言实现地理信息系统的基本功能,包括空间数据与属性数据的管理、分析及可视化等。全书内容均为底层开发,不依赖于任何商业地理信息系统软件,各种算法或数据操作方法均有详细介绍,且深入浅出。通过阅读本书,希望提高读者的原始创新能力。 第1章介绍了如何实现一个最小化的地理信息系统,第2章搭建了一个底层开发的基本框架,第3至5章讲述了地理信息可视化的基本要点,第6章介绍了矢量图层,第7章讲述鼠标在地理信息浏览中的作用,第8至11章介绍Shapefile文件的读取以及如何自定义地理信息系统数据文件格式,第12至14章介绍空间及属性信息的选择方法,第15章介绍栅格图层,第16章介绍多图层管理,第17章实现了一个基本的地理信息系统集成控件,第18及19章介绍了地理
本书从应用开发角度,根据作者多年的工作经验,介绍Python语言在开源GIS中的应用。希望能够借此机会,使得开源GIS得到应用,并进一步推广开源GIS的理念与技术。本书主要以空间数据的处理、分析以及地图制图为主线。在选择内容时,本书以目前最为经典、常用的类库为主,目的是给初学者系统地讲解基本的概念。书中用到一些数据,并有代码,这些资源都可以从网站上下载,并且网站上的内容也会有相应的更新。书中代码经过了测试,可以在Linux操作系统中运行,大部分也可以在Windows操作系统中运行。
本教程面向大多数GIS专业及其相关专业读者群体,突出“开源”和“应用分析”特色,以具体案例形式,介绍QGIS软件的基本数据操作和空间分析功能,包括QGIS数据加载、浏览、专题地图制作、打印输出;QGIS空间配准、栅格矢量化、实体生成、GPS连接等数据采集和编辑操作;QGIS空间缓冲区和泰森多边形分析;QGIS热力图表达和核密度分析;“PostGIS+QGIS”关系数据库建库及空间SQL分析;PostGIS空间网络拓扑处理与可达性分析;PostGIS综合空间分析应用。
在中华人民共和国成立七十五周年之际,我国遥感科学与技术领域最早开拓者之一的童庆禧院士即将迎来他人生九十华诞。童院士见证了中国由弱到强史诗般飞跃,也亲历实践了中国遥感事业从诞生成长到壮大辉煌的绚丽历史进程。本书图文并茂,详细介绍了童院士的主要人生经历。他参加了珠峰第一次科考,参与了中国遥感初创发展规划的制定;策划组织了我国早期的新疆哈密、云南腾冲及津渤综合遥感实验;主持建成了先进的高空机载遥感实用系统;开创了我国高光谱遥感科学与应用领域;推动了高性能对地观测小卫星系统研制、国际合作与商业运营;倡导组建了北京大学数字中国研究院,促进了数字中国的研究。他精心培养了一大批优秀遥感人才。本书是对童院士从事遥感工作六十年的阶段性总结,也为中国遥感科技发展史研究提供了一份珍贵的历史文献。
目前,基于计算机与互联网应用的移动地理信息系统(MGIS或MobileGIS)正在兴起,GIS技术把地图这种独特的视觉化效果和地理分析功能与一般的数据库操作集成在一起。本书引入了当前热门的计算机移动应用开发实例,细讲述开发环境、开发语言等要素,带领读者逐步完成复杂程度越来越高的计算机应用程序开发项目,每个项目中都引入一种新的移动应用平台特性,并着重指出有助于编写引人入胜的移动应用程序的技术和实践。是学习使用开发移动应用程序的理想指南。
本书分为十章,作者从时代背景和理论基础出发,分别从互联网治理的时代背景、相关概念界定、相关研究几方面展开讨论,进而引出关于互联网治理现状和问题的分析,提出互联网协调治理的政策设计设想,方案,对大数背景下中国互联网治理政策文件进行了梳理和总结。此外,作者在书稿中以新冠肺炎疫情这一公共突发事件治理为研究案例,以图表形式详细地进行基于SIR模型的有限区域内新冠肺炎疫情仿真模拟研究,并针对三次模拟结论,分别提出相应的对策和建议。
本书立足实战,讲解近期新的%26nbsp;ArCGIS桌面系统的基本操作方法,从地理数据的显示、编辑、查询和管理的角度介绍了桌面的应用,并介绍扩展模块及综合实战案例。全书穿插了大量的应用实例,是作
本书为2l世纪交通版高等学校,书中全面介绍了卫星导航定位系统中GPS的测量原理及其应用,主要內容包括:卫星大地测量基本知识、GPS定位的基本原理、差分GPS定位原理、GPS测量控制网设计与实施、GPS测量数据处理、GPS精密高程测量以及GPS工程应用等。同时对GPS之外的三个卫星导航定位系统有较为深入的系统介绍,对网络RTK和精密单点定位(PPP)的定位原理也有深入介绍。本书概念清晰、通俗易懂、实用性强,可作为高等院校测绘类或相关专业本科生以及研究生的通用,也可供测绘、交通、国土、城建、水电、地质、采矿等部门从事GPS工作的科技工作者参考。
ArcGISServer是功能强大的基于服务器的地理信息系统产品,本书以循序渐进的方式,通过大量的实例介绍如何在VisualStudio中,使用C#语言开发基于ArcGISServer的WebGIS。全书内容涉及使用ArcGISServer开发WebGIS的各个层面,包括ArcGISServer9.2的功能、架构及安装介绍,ArcGISServer的管理、服务的发布以及配置文件的使用,自定义工具与命令的创建,数据源、图形对象类、任务的自定义及操作,ArcGIS服务器功能的扩展,以及如何直接使用ArcGISServer提供的Web服务开发程序并对其进行再封装。最后介绍了WebGIS中的安全、部署以及性能调优应考虑的关键问题。本书适用于政府、企业相关部门的GIS研究与开发人员,也适用于高等院校地理学、地理信息系统、房地产、环境科学、资源与城乡规划管理、区域经济学等专业学生参考与学习。本书还适合作为各种GIS培训学员的学习教材与参考书。
《ArcGIS地理信息系统基础与实训(第2版)》作为创新型二合一教材,既是一本通俗易懂的GIS入门教材,也可以充当ArcGIS实训手册。《ArcGIS地理信息系统基础与实训(第2版)》可读性强,信息量大,著述方式妙趣横生,覆盖GIS基本原理和软件应用。全书共10章,全面覆盖GIS从业人员需要了解的知识点和技能,是帮助他们熟练掌握GIS软件应用的理想参考。《ArcGIS地理信息系统基础与实训(第2版)》适合GIS和相关专业学生使用,也可作为GIS从业人员的实践指南。
本书根据作者多年的遥感应用实践和遥感课程教学经验编写而成,系统地介绍了遥感数据处理软件ERDASIMAGINE的基本模块与基本操作(包括数据输入/输出、AOI编辑、数据格式转换、图像裁剪、图像镶嵌)、遥感图像的投影变换与几何校正、遥感图像增强处理、遥感图像融合处理、高光谱数据处理、无人机遥感测量、遥感图像分类、矢量数据编辑、遥感解译与制图等内容。本书将遥感数据处理理论方法和遥感数据处理应用实践相结合,可作为遥感科学与技术、地理信息科学、测绘工程、城乡规划、地理学等专业的本科实验教材,也可以作为地图学、环境科学、环境生态学、地理信息系统、遥感信息科学等专业的研究生以及相关研究人员、应用工程技术人员的参考用书。
MapInfo是美国MapInfo公司推出的桌面地图信息系统,它提供了二次开发平台,用户可以在该平台上开发各自的GIS应用。二次开发方法归结起来有3种,它们是基于MapBasic的开发、基于OLE自动化的开发及利用MapX控件的开发。本书以实例详细讲述了这3种方法的开发过程,并给出了目前MapInfo系统没有提供的绘制等值线、矢量图等程序。本书讲述的开发过程,均提供源程序,它对地理信息系统开发人员,特别是利用MapInfo进行二次开发的人员极有帮助。同时,本书也可作为各大专院校学生学习MapInfo二次开发的参考书。本书附赠光盘内容为书中的实例源程序,供读者学习参考用。
OpenLayers作为业内使用最为广泛的地图引擎之一,已被各大GIS厂商和广大WebGIS二次开发者采用。借助OpenLayers强大的扩展功能,可以实现与各个不同的WebGIS平台产品相结合,开发出各具特色的WebGIS应用系统。本书主要内容涵盖:WebGIS开发基础、OpenLayers开发基础、OpenLayers快速入门、OpenLayers之多源数据加载、OpenLayers之图形绘制、OpenLayers之OGC、OpenLayers之高级功能,最后给出了OpenLayers之项目实战——水利信息在线分析服务系统。
《GPS理论算法与应用(第2版)》系统阐述了GPS基本理论和方法,包括GPS测量涉及的坐标系和时间系统、卫星轨道计算、GPS观测量和误差源、GPS观测方程的建立、数据处理的各种平差和滤波方法、周跳探测和整周模糊度解算方法等;书中还介绍了一些作者的创新研究成果。如基于消参数等价观测方程的GPS数据处理方法、整周模糊度搜索的一般准则和等价准则、模糊度搜索的对角化算法等。本书描述了一些具体的GPS应用系统的建设及应用情况,包括作者在波茨坦地学研究中心组织研制的动态/静态GPS/Galileo软件MFGSoft的结构,以及参与欧洲AGMASCO计划中机载遥感系统的精密动态定位和飞行状态监视两个项目的应用隋况,具有很强的工程指导价值。本书相对版完善了部分内容,增加了一些本领域的进展:同时详细讨论。TGPS数据处理的等价性和GPS观测模型的独立参数化,使